The GUNT Elements for Energy Dissipation HM 162.35 are designed to dissipate high energy flows downstream of control structures in the HM 162 flume. They are used in combination with the Ogee-Crested Weir HM 162.32 to study hydraulic jumps and flow energy reduction.
Product Features
- Set of elements including chute blocks, baffle blocks, and end sills
- End sills create stilling basins and stabilize hydraulic jumps
- Chute block can replace a weir outlet of HM 162.32
- Baffle blocks and end sills can be used individually or in combination
- All elements are mounted on a base plate for easy setup
